SILVERBACK TREEWORKS LTD
Now Hiring: Office Manager, Client Experience
About the Role
Since 2007, Silverback Treeworks has cared for the trees that shape our communities across Greater Vancouver and the Sea to Sky corridor. We're a locally owned team of ISA-certified arborists who take pride in doing things right, and we're looking for an Office Manager to help us keep that promise to our clients and our crews.
This isn't a role where you'll get lost in a big corporate structure. You'll keep the office side of the business running smoothly: the face of our company for clients and visitors, and the go-to person our crews rely on to keep things moving across our Squamish, North Vancouver, and Burnaby yards.
If you want a role with real ownership, enjoy staying organized in a fast-moving environment, and would rather be part of a tight-knit, outdoors-minded team than sit in a cubicle all day, this is worth a look.
What a Day Looks Like
No two days are the same, but here's a sense of what you'd be doing:
● Answer phones, emails, and online inquiries, and book consultations, quotes, and jobs for clients across all three yards
● Greet a client walking in for a quote, or a supplier dropping off gear, and make sure they leave with a good impression of Silverback
● Adjust the day's crew schedule with arborists and yard leads when a job runs long, weather shifts, or equipment needs change
● Place an order for PPE, fuel, uniforms, or other supplies before the yard runs low, and manage the vendor relationships behind them
● Process an invoice or purchase order and check in with our bookkeeper on day-to-day financial admin
● Help onboard a new hire, update an employee file, or answer a question about office procedure
● Plan an upcoming company event or team meeting, or sort out travel details for someone on the team
● Build or tweak the systems and procedures that keep three separate yards running like one team, not three
Qualifications
● Demonstrated customer service excellence: professional, personable, and calm under pressure
● Strong logistical and organizational skills are a big asset. You naturally keep things on track and stay one step ahead, especially when priorities shift
● 3+ years in office management, administration, or a hospitality/service-oriented role
● Strong communication and time-management skills
● Proficiency with standard office software (e.g., Microsoft Office or Google Workspace)
● Discretion with confidential information and a genuine desire to help others
